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 15/06/2017, à 16:36

qolepam

nombre de bits occupés par un type du langage c

bonjour,

Je crois qu'il y a une commande unix listant le nombre de bits occupés par un type du langage c.
int
float
char
etc...
Je ne sais plus laquelle est cette commande?

merci de votre aide

Hors ligne

#2 Le 15/06/2017, à 18:49

pingouinux

Re : nombre de bits occupés par un type du langage c

Bonsoir,
Pourquoi n'écris-tu pas un petit programme en C utilisant sizeof ?

printf( "Longueur d'un %-12s = %2ld\n", "int", sizeof(int) );

Ajouté : Ceci va te donner le nombre d'octets occupé par le type

Dernière modification par pingouinux (Le 15/06/2017, à 19:53)

Hors ligne

#3 Le 15/06/2017, à 19:46

Watael

Re : nombre de bits occupés par un type du langage c

en ligne de commande ?
ou dans un code C ?


Connected \o/
Welcome to sHell. · eval is evil.

Hors ligne

#4 Le 15/06/2017, à 20:35

qolepam

Re : nombre de bits occupés par un type du langage c

en ligne de commande

Hors ligne

#5 Le 15/06/2017, à 21:06

Watael

Re : nombre de bits occupés par un type du langage c

mais les types que tu cites n'existent pas sur la ligne de commande.
sur la ligne de commande, il n'y a que des chaînes.

si on demande gentiment au shell, il peut considérer des variables comme étant du type entier (les floats n'existent pas).
ça ne va pas plus loin.

il faut préciser ton propos, et le contexte.

Dernière modification par Watael (Le 15/06/2017, à 21:08)


Connected \o/
Welcome to sHell. · eval is evil.

Hors ligne

#6 Le 16/06/2017, à 07:50

serged

Re : nombre de bits occupés par un type du langage c

qolepam a écrit :

en ligne de commande

Non, c'est du C (en bash les variables n'ont pas de type a priori).


LinuxMint Vera Cinnamon et d'autres machines en MATE, XFCE... 20.x , 21.x ou 19.x
Tour : Asus F2A55 / AMD A8-5600K APU 3,6GHz / RAM 16Go / Nvidia GeForce GT610 / LM21.1 Cinnamon
Portable : LDLC Mercure MH : Celeron N3450 /RAM 4Go / Intel HD graphics 500 i915 / biboot Win 10 (sur SSD) - LM21.1 MATE (sur HDD)

Hors ligne

#7 Le 16/06/2017, à 10:15

bruno

Re : nombre de bits occupés par un type du langage c

serged a écrit :

en bash les variables n'ont pas de type a priori

http://www.tldp.org/LDP/Bash-Beginners- … 10_01.html

Hors ligne